"Consumers are typically not learning about new brands, products and services from social media. Only 6.5% of US internet users said they most frequently hear about new brands, products and services from social media, while 17.6% said they often do and 26.5% said they sometimes do. A quarter of respondents (26%) said they never hear about these new offerings via social media.
Offline channels, such as TV, radio and print media were the ways consumers most frequently discovered new brands, products and services, while word-of-mouth and physical stores also played a role. US internet users also learned about new offerings more often from online elements that are not social media, such as online advertising or online shopping sites, than they do on social media."
